kzt wrote:It’s also the name of a very famous philosopher.
https://en.m.wikipedia.org/wiki/Jean-Jacques_Rousseau


Rousseau's 1762 CE treatise, "Emile or On Education" is considered the first modern work discussing the education of the common man, equating his capability to that of a young nobleman, when given the chance (Moore and Bacon's contemporary works on education only spoke of educating noblemen). It is often called "The Slow-match of the French Revolution" and was used as the ideal when creating the post revolutionary educational system.
